Hamilton is a small, unincorporated community located in Fillmore County, Minnesota, in the United States. An "unincorporated community" means it's a place where people live, but it doesn't have its own local government like a city or town. Instead, it's usually managed by the county.

A Glimpse into Hamilton's Past

Hamilton was officially planned and mapped out in 1855. This process is called "platting." It means someone drew up the first maps showing where streets and lots would be. A post office opened in Hamilton in 1863. This was an important place for people to send and receive mail. The post office served the community for many years, closing its doors in 1904.

Famous People from Hamilton

Some notable individuals have connections to Hamilton. They include:

  • Albert Plummer: He was a physician, which is a doctor. He also served as a legislator, meaning he was a person who helped make laws for the state.
  • Henry Stanley Plummer: He was also a physician.
